Dear All,

1.The IGC's first priority should be in electing a new co-coordinator to
replace the vacancy from 2017. 2 years has lapsed which is substantial
delay.

2.The conflict stemming from several discussions lie in ignorance of the
IGC charter which could have easily been avoided if the coordinators
delivered the website in 2017 as was promised then. The website also
contains a record of members.

3.Jeremy has offered to pay for IGC website hosting. It follows that Bruna
needs to find someone to build the website.

4. It is not good practice to have a single coordinator as two are needed
to reason, and work together. Bruna cannot be expected to do things alone
hence the need to accelerate the overdue electoral process.

5. In terms of the electoral process, if Bruna is struggling, a call may be
put to the Community to recommend a neutral entity or create a platform to
conduct the elections.

6.It is the height of irony to desire to put external civil society
coordination, before cleaning up our organisational mess and getting our
coordinators in place.

7.Delaying the elections to November means that we will be calling for both
coordinators replacements as Bruna rotates out once call is issued and
there is no sustainability as is why one would rotate out one year and the
other the next.

8.As has been the practice, we engage in discussion on the list until we
reach consensus which is the role of the coordinators to facilitate.

>>>> Dear colleagues,
>>>>
>>>>
>>>> It is time to elect a new Co-coordinator for the Caucus, to replace
>>>> Analía who has already completed her two-year term, and to work with me
>>>> (Arsene). As you know, the IGC is operating with two volunteers called
>>>> “Co-coordinators”.
>>>>
>>>>
>>>> I would like to send my apologies for the time it took me to quick
>>>> start this process; as you know, we have been busy with migrating our
>>>> server but also I informed that I will be launching this once we have
>>>> submitted our workshop proposal to the upcoming IGF (which we did today).
>>>> This is an usual process and I beg you to bear with me. You will remember I
>>>> did launch this call while we were still working on the server but so many
>>>> of you only saw it later on when the system was restored back.
>>>>
>>>>
>>>> We invite members of the IGC to nominate candidates (please check with
>>>> them first about their willingness to serve), or to nominate themselves as
>>>> Co-coordinator to serve for 2 years, from 2017-2019. All you need to do is
>>>> to send TO THE LIST your statement of interest (in the body of an email and
>>>> attached in a .doc file) with the following elements:
>>>>
>>>> -          Your full name
>>>>
>>>> -          Your country of origin and of residence
>>>>
>>>> -          Anything we need to know about your work/involvement with
>>>> IGC/IGF/Civil Society activities. (200 words max)
>>>>
>>>> -          Why do you think you can be a good Co-coordinator for the
>>>> IGC? (Max 200 words)
>>>>
>>>> -          What’s your vision for the IGC during your term if elected?
>>>> Pick up to 3 current issues we face in the group that you will consider as
>>>> priority during your first year. (Max 200 words)
>>>>
>>>>
>>>> The nomination period will be open until midnight UTC on May 10th,
>>>> 2017. After this date, we will circulate a resume of candidate's profiles
>>>> and enable a voting link to all IGC members in order to elect our new
>>>> co-coordinator.
